Output 1724d90a39938e06127a90377d00e0568bf41e99e84fd5cb16ed528b62649804:4

value
367934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fb383447d9f04647808229a2782ad9bd9cba16 OP_EQUAL
address
36XA1ZP8gHNLtVmYroLL4Btn485ircoQzh
transaction
1724d90a39938e06127a90377d00e0568bf41e99e84fd5cb16ed528b62649804
confirmations
319099
spent
true